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Road (Guildford) to Woodbridge start from as little as £20.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Road (Guildford) to Woodbridge start from £67.90 one way, or £68.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Road (Guildford) to Woodbridge are available for £100.40 one way, or £149.60 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

London Road (Guildford) station is well-equipped for your travel needs.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and 09:00 to 14:00 on Saturdays. While there's no ticket office service on Sundays, ticket machines are available for you to buy and collect tickets at any time. Additionally, these machines are accessible for individuals with disabilities, and induction loops are available for those with hearing impairments.

The station features heated waiting rooms on both platforms and CCTV for your safety. However, it's worth noting that facilities such as shops, ATM machines, and refreshment outlets are not available on-site, so it's a good idea to plan ahead if you require these services.

Accessibility

This station prioritizes accessibility with some step-free access available. While platform 2, which services trains towards Guildford, offers level access, platform 1 does not have step-free access. Assistance for boarding or alighting from trains is handled by the train's guard, and while dedicated staff help isn't available, customer help points are on site to assist passengers.

Accessible parking is available with two designated spaces, though you might want to confirm details ahead as equipment for accessible parking is not provided.

Facilities and Amenities at Woodbridge Station

Woodbridge Train Station is a small, yet efficient station. Although it lacks a ticket office, travelers can utilize ticket machines available on site for purchasing and collecting tickets. For those who have purchased tickets online, they can easily be retrieved from the ticket machine. The station also accommodates passengers with disabilities by providing an accessible ticket machine, which accepts card payments only.

Passenger convenience is enhanced with the provision of customer help points, where informational screens offer up-to-date announcements about departures and services. The station is equipped with CCTV for safety, though it does lack waiting rooms and toilets; however, there are seating areas available for travelers waiting for their trains.

Getting Around: Transport Connections

The station is situated close to local transport options, making onward travel smooth and hassle-free. While Woodbridge doesn’t offer bicycle hire or accessible taxis, rail replacement services pick up and drop off at the bus stops at the entrance to the station car park, ensuring that service disruptions won’t hinder your travel plans. For those driving to the station, East Suffolk Council operates a car park that boasts 72 spaces, including 3 accessible parking spots, and charges no fee for parking.
